Things You'll Need:
- Thin wooden rod or long sturdy straw
- purple ribbon
- Glue Gun
- yarn in Abby colors (blue, purple, pink and yellow)
- thin wire or strong string
- Tape
-
Step 1
Take all your Abby Cadabby colored yarn and cut several strands of each color in the same length. Cut the yarn longer than you think you will need it because you can always trim it later.
-
Step 2
Gather all your strips of yarn together so they are lined up. In the middle, wrap the thin wire or string around and tie a tight knot, securing the yarn pieces together.
-
Step 3
Take your wooden rod or straw and put the center of the tied yarn on the tip of the rod. Take the wire (or string) and tightly wrap it around the rod. Use some tape to secure it in place.
-
Step 4
Now, starting right below the yarn at the top of your wand, put a dab of hot glue from your glue gun. Take the purple ribbon and secure it onto the wand. Now, carefully wrap the ribbon around the wand, working your way down the wand. You can add dabs of hot glue along the way to make it more secure. Once you get to the bottom of the wand, trim the ribbon. Fold the unfinished edge under and glue it down.
-
Step 5
Fluff up your yarn pom-pom at the top of the wand. Trim the length of the yarn if needed. Now let your child POOF! away!
